CF Industries wins international CANstruction award

Sarnia's CF Industries has won an international prize for its 2024 CANstruction build.

Inn of the Good Shepherd Executive Director Myles Vanni said their Star Wars design -- called CAN or CANnot, There is No Try -- depicted a Death Star on one side and Luke Skywalker and Darth Vader on the other.

It was awarded the People's Choice Award in the CANstruction International Competition -- which was one of six international award categories.

“Communities around the world participate in CANstruction each year and each community may have six to 20 builds,” said Vanni.

CF Industries was the only Canadian winner, sharing the list with builds from Hong Kong and the United States. “Considering such a large field of competition, to be named International People’s Choice is a real testament to the team’s creativity, innovation and deep commitment to addressing hunger in our community,” Vanni added.

The display included over 8,200 items and featured glowing lightsabers.

Vanni delivered the award to team members: Maranda Jessup, Davina Anderson, Haley Cadwallader, Kyle Watson, Kevin Paul, Nick Burgel, Chris Dobbelaar and Megan Burnett late last week.

Paul said they were honoured.

“The CF team looks forward to the event every year, as it is a great cause that generates meaningful support for our local foodbank and brings together team members from every department of our site,” said Paul.

The display won Judge's Favourite, Best Use of Labels, and Structural Ingenuity during the 2024 event at Lambton Mall.

CF Industries also won the Judge's Favourite award in the 2025 Sarnia competition, for a third year in a row.
